Revenge Shopping – How Aussie Businesses Can Capitalise on the splurge!

As Australia slowly emerges out of lockdown, revenge shopping is on the rise with customers flocking to retail stores to spend their lockdown savings, and Custom Neon have the tips retailers need to prepare.

Revenge shopping is when customers splurge after a frugal spending period. Many Australians cut back on spending during the pandemic, and now that the country is coming out of lockdown, revenge shopping is on the rise. Custom Neon have compiled a list of tips that retailers can utilise to avoid chaos. This includes stocking up your inventory, levelling up on your customer service skills, updating store signage, practicing safe social distancing and sharing enticing in-store incentives.

“Prompt customers to visit your store with exclusive in-store deals and incentives” is just one tip author Courtney Stables includes.

Revenge shopping is a great time for brick-and-mortar retailers, as it means more people are spending money, taking the retail sector from doom to boom.
